Tiger Woods Mocked In Spirit Airlines Ad

The Tiger Woods car crash/sex scandal is already being memed on the interwebz and surprisingly the meme didn’t originate on 4chan or Something Awful but on a Spirit Airlines advertisement.
The airline, based in Florida, employs an animated Bengal Tiger crashing a car into a fire hydrant followed by an announcement for their appropriately named “eye of the tiger” sale where you can find flights for as little as $9.
